If you ride for long enough, falling off is nearly inevitable. Join us to learn techniques to mitigate the risk of serious injury.
Justin Moses, professional stunt coordinator and owner of Steel and Steed Stunts, will take you through a series of exercises designed to help you learn how to move your body during a fall to minimize injuries. We will be beginning on the mats, moving to a stationary practice stand and finally working on falling from a real horse in a safe way.
